Gora Zangi
Gora Zangi is a mountain in Ismayilli District, Azerbaijan and has an elevation of 2,014 metres. Gora Zangi is situated nearby to the area Qanlıyurd Ayrığı, as well as near Çölbayr Ayrığı.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Lahich
Photo: Nazimsamadov,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Lahıc is a village and municipality on the southern slopes of Greater Caucasus within the Ismailli Rayon of Azerbaijan. Population is approximately 860 people who speak the Tat language, also known as Tati Persian, a Southwestern Iranian language spoken by the Tats of Azerbaijan and Russia.
